Day 4: Corvaro – Cartore
From Corvaro, leave the village and take the path that climbs to the Duchessa along a beautiful path through the beech forest, without difficulty, very wild but well marked, to the Duchessa Lake. From here you can descend to the valley, either to Cartore (via the Val di Fua or Prati di San Leonardo), or to Rosciolo (via the Val di Teve).

Long variant through the Teve valley
- km 21.1
- height difference in ascent 1280 m
- height difference on descent 1200 m
When you reach Lago della Duchessa, you climb further up to 2100 m, then descend to Malopasso and Capo di Teve. You ride all the way through the beautiful Val di Teve, until you exit the valley. if you turn right, you will reach Cartore in about a kilometre. if you want to extend the stage by another 8 km, making it 29 km (be careful, it is very long) you can go directly to Rosciolo.
Loop variant from Cartore
There are two possibilities, an easier one of 12 km (ascent from Val di Fua and descent from Prati di San Leonardo) and one of 17 km (through Val di Teve), but much longer in height difference and only for experienced hikers. Both possibilities are described in detail in the book.
Third possibility (not described in the guidebook): from Cartore it is possible to make a variant off the Cammino, climbing Mount Velino (2489 m), sleeping at the Rifugio Sebastiani and returning by another path to Santa Maria in Valle, in two days' walking. A summer variant for very well-trained walkers who are well prepared to move along difficult, poorly marked paths. The terrain is high mountain, severe and airy. For this variant you must have a topographical map of Monte Velino, and follow the paths, trying not to lose them.
